Partager via


D3DKMTCheckVidPnExclusiveOwnership, fonction (d3dkmthk.h)

La fonction D3DKMTCheckVidPnExclusiveOwnership détermine la source de la vidéo présente dans le chemin d’accès d’une topologie de réseau présent vidéo (VidPN) qui possède exclusivement le VidPN.

Syntaxe

NTSTATUS D3DKMTCheckVidPnExclusiveOwnership(
  [in] const D3DKMT_CHECKVIDPNEXCLUSIVEOWNERSHIP *unnamedParam1
);

Paramètres

[in] unnamedParam1

Pointeur vers une structure D3DKMT_CHECKVIDPNEXCLUSIVEOWNERSHIP qui décrit les paramètres permettant de déterminer la propriété VidPN exclusive.

Valeur retournée

D3DKMTCheckVidPnExclusiveOwnership retourne l’une des valeurs suivantes :

Code de retour Description
STATUS_SUCCESS La propriété exclusive du VidPN a été déterminée avec succès.
STATUS_DEVICE_REMOVED La carte graphique a été arrêtée ou le périphérique d’affichage a été réinitialisé.
STATUS_GRAPHICS_VIDPN_SOURCE_IN_USE La source présente de la vidéo identifiée par le membre VidPnSourceId de D3DKMT_CHECKVIDPNEXCLUSIVEOWNERSHIP appartient déjà à un client de gestionnaire de mode d’affichage (DMM) et ne peut pas être utilisée tant que le client n’a pas libéré la source actuelle de la vidéo.
STATUS_GRAPHICS_INVALID_VIDEO_PRESENT_SOURCE La source de présentation de la vidéo identifiée par le membre VidPnSourceId de D3DKMT_CHECKVIDPNEXCLUSIVEOWNERSHIP n’est pas valide.
STATUS_INVALID_PARAMETER Les paramètres ont été validés et déterminés comme incorrects.

Cette fonction peut également retourner d’autres valeurs NTSTATUS .

Configuration requise

Condition requise Valeur
Client minimal pris en charge D3DKMTCheckVidPnExclusiveOwnership est pris en charge à partir du système d’exploitation Windows 7.
Plateforme cible Universal
En-tête d3dkmthk.h (include D3dkmthk.h)
Bibliothèque Gdi32.lib
DLL Gdi32.dll

Voir aussi

D3DKMT_CHECKVIDPNEXCLUSIVEOWNERSHIP